Thrill Me: The Leopold & Loeb Story at Waterloo East Theatre

Chilling yet thrilling A dark musical written by award-winning Stephen Dolginoff, based on the true story of the legendary duo who committed one of the most infamous crimes of the twentieth century, the murder of 14-year-old Bobby Franks in Chicago, May 21st, 1924, writes Linda Emmanuel.
